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Sendible
- Advertised starting prices per workspace understate typical cost, since real usage across multiple profiles quickly pushes buyers into higher tiers.
- Assignment and approval workflows are withheld from the entry-level Core plan, limiting it to solo or unmanaged use.
- Custom branded client reports require at least the Premium tier, adding cost for agencies that need white-labeling early.
Snapchat
- Screenshots and screen recordings can be captured by third-party apps despite notifications to the sender
- Limited appeal to users over 35 reduces effectiveness for broader marketing demographics
- No native API for organic content publishing, requiring workarounds for automation
- Disappearing messages create poor archival for business communications

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Sendible: What does Sendible cost?
Plans start at Core for $1 per workspace/month, rising through Plus, Premium, and Elite, up to Enterprise at $50 per workspace/month, each unlocking more workspaces and profiles.

No. Snapchat requires an internet connection to send and receive messages. Snaps will not deliver without internet connectivity.

Sendible offers a 14-day free trial with no card required and no contract commitment.

Yes, Snapchat is free to download and use with all core features at no cost. A premium subscription, Snapchat Plus, costs $3.99/month and adds features like story rewatch counts and custom app icons.

Every plan, from Core through Enterprise, includes unlimited users regardless of workspace or profile count.

Snapchat provides data download through Memories, but snaps disappear after viewing unless saved to Memories. The app provides limited export functionality for archived content.

Sendible supports Instagram, Facebook, TikTok, LinkedIn, Google My Business, YouTube, Threads, and Bluesky across its plans.

No. Snapchat has no documented public API for posting Snaps, Stories, or Spotlight content programmatically. Only the Marketing API (ads) and Lens Studio API are available for developers.
